dataTables.markjs

Mark.js

  • Author: Julian Kühnel, SpryMedia Ltd
  • Requires: DataTables 3+

It can sometimes be useful to get a visual indication of where search terms are in a result set, which is exactly that this library does! It uses Mark.js to highlight search terms, updating on each draw as required.

To enable, make sure you load Mark.js on your page (as well as this plug-in) and then add mark: true to your DataTables initialisation. * License: MIT

NPM

The plug-ins are all available on NPM (which can also be used with Yarn or any other Javascript package manager) as part of the datatables.net-plugins package. To use this plug-in, first install the plug-ins package:

npm install datatables.net-plugins

Then import datatables.net, any other DataTables extensions you need, plus the plug-in:

import DataTable from 'datatables.net';
import 'datatables.net-plugins/features/markjs/dist/dataTables.markjs.mjs';

Example

new DataTable('#myTable', {
   mark: true
 });
